Functional Block Diagram
A complete CI862K01 unit consists of a TP862 baseplate, a CI862 communication
interface board, and their mechanics, Figure 80. All electronic devices and all
functions are located on the board which also includes the µGenie slave module.
The baseplate and CI862 are connected via an 80-pin edge connector. Connections
to the outside world are made on the baseplate.
Figure 80. CI862 functionality
The baseplate contains only passive elements. It holds the input and output
connectors for the CEX-Bus, a slot for the CI862 unit, a port used for the Genius
Bus Hand Held Monitor, a high speed serial port used for module redundancy link
communications and a port for the TRIO Field Bus connection.

CI862 contains the Coldfire MCF5307 Microcontroller with Flash memory, RAM,
LED indicators, power supply, and CEX-Bus interface with dual port memory,
bridged to a GE/Fanuc µGenie Communication Module. The µGenie handles all
data transfer between the CI862 Carrier module and the TRIO FIELD BUS,
allowing the Carrier CPU to control the remote I/O.
Indicators
LED indicators for R(un), F(ault), Communication Error, Primary (Bus Master), and
Dual (redundancy)
Technical Data
Table 95. TRIO/Genius interface CI862
Item Value
Bus Type Daisy-chained bus cable; single twisted pair plus shield
or Twinax.
Protocol similar to the RS422 standard
Communication speed 153.6 ext, 38.4, 76.8, 153.6 std kbit/s
Bus Capacity (one segment) Max 32 devices. 16 devices at 38.4
Kbaud. Includes CI862 and Hand-held Monitor.
Bus Termination 75, 100, 120, or 150 ohm resistor at both ends of
electrical bus cable.
Maximum Bus Length 7500 feet at 38.4 Kbaud, 4500 feet at 76.8 Kbaud, 3500
feet at 153.6 Kbaud extended, 2000 feet at 153.6 Kbaud,
standard. Maximum length at each baud rate also
depends on cable type.
Galvanic Isolation Yes
Status Indicators Red LED for error
Green LED for run
Yellow LED for traffic
Yellow LED for primary
Yellow LED for dual mode

CI865 and TP865 – Satt I/O Interface
Key Features
• Provides one ControlNet port, (a BNC connector
located on the TP865 Baseplate).
• Simple DIN-rail mounting.
• Handles I/O scanning of up to 31 distributed I/O
nodes.
• Pre-set, two-letter Alpha code locking device
installed in unit base prevents mounting of
incompatible components.
• Supports Hot swap.
Description
The CI865/TP865 connects ControlNet to AC 800M. The
module makes it possible to use older Satt I/O system
(Rack I/O and Series 200 I/O) with the AC 800M
controller platform but it can not be used as a general
ControlNet interface. The TP865 Baseplate has one BNC
connector for connecting I/O racks. The baseplate has a
code lock, see Table 4 on page 75, that prevents
installation of an incorrect type of unit onto the TP865
Baseplate.
The CI865 expansion unit contains the CEX-Bus logic, ControlNet bus logic, CPU
and a DC/DC converter that supplies appropriate voltages from the +24 V supply,
via the CEX-Bus.
